The state of the art in X-ray diagnostic. An overview

In modern X-ray diagnostic, the transformation from the analog film-based systems to a purely digital application is going on in a high speed. The digital technology is based on X-ray detectors which are able to produce electric signals. These can convert into digital information and generate by computers to radiological images. With this link the next step is consequential: the networking of all radiological modalities by a system called picture archiving and communication system (PACS). The ''digital revolution'' has a great influence on the ratio between image quality and dose rate: It is feasible to decrease the dose rate without significant losses of image quality or - on the other hand - to improve the image quality without a significant increase of the dose rate.
